Impact of Homogenization Management on Professional Skills of Medical Staff and Patient Satisfaction in Hospitals under the Integrated Health Care System Model
Objective To analyze the impact of homogenization management on medical staff's professional skills and patient satisfaction in hospitals of integrated health care system.Methods 200 medical personnel in the integrated health care system of Nantong Maternal and Child Health Hospital were selected as the study object,the control group practiced routine management from January to June 2022,and 480 cases of patients were selected for consultation.The observation group practiced homogenized management from July to December 2022,and 480 patients were se-lected for consultation.The two groups were compared in terms of medical staff's professional skills,management qual-ity and patients'visit satisfaction scores.Results The scores of the case analysis,basic operation,history taking,physical examination,differential diagnosis and treatment,medical record writing of the medical staff in the observa-tion group were 95.88±2.67,97.08±0.49,96.24±2.77,98.33±0.17,96.85±2.78,and 99.14±0.09,respectively,which were higher than those of the control group,and the differences were statistically significant(t=19.268,57.687,20.906,167.042,20.570,33.033,all P<0.05).The management quality score of the observation group was higher than that of the control group,and the differences were statistically significant(all P<0.05).The scores of patients'consulta-tion satisfaction in the observation group were higher than those in the control group,and the difference was statisti-cally significant(all P<0.05).Conclusion The use of homogenization management in the integrated health care system can effectively improve the professional skills of medical personnel,and patient satisfaction is high.
